I'm trying to implement a function to retrieve the translation and rotation of the parts in an assembly step file. I found the function read_step_file_with_names_colors(filename) inside DataExchange.py with the locations commented, and implemented in my code. When I get the numbers, they match perfectly with the parameters shown in a CAD program e.g. FreeCAD.
However, the positions are exactly the same for different parts, both in FreeCAD data and in my output, which I know not to be true, as they are shown in FreeCAD in different locations. I've read something in the internet about the vertices of a part actually being in the correct positions, but I have no idea how to implement that.
Is there a way to actually getting the correct position of a part in the "world" of the assembly?
